Description of problem: I upgraded firefox with 'yum install firefox' and the Java application I run in my browser to access a IP-KVM stopped working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able): java-1.6.0-openjdk-1.6.0.0-19.b14.fc11.x86_64 java-1.6.0-openjdk-plugin-1.6.0.0-19.b14.fc11.x86_64 java-1.6.0-openjdk-1.6.0.0-20.b14.fc11.x86_64 java-1.6.0-openjdk-plugin-1.6.0.0-20.b14.fc11.x86_64 firefox-3.1-0.11.beta3.fc11.x86_64 firefox-3.5-0.20.beta4.fc11.x86_64 How reproducible: Steps to Reproduce: 1. Install java-1.6.0-openjdk-1.6.0.0-19.b14.fc11.x86_64 2. Install java-1.6.0-openjdk-plugin-1.6.0.0-19.b14.fc11.x86_64 3. Install firefox-3.5-0.20.beta4.fc11.x86_64 4. ... go to a webpage that uses java I guess. Actual results: Java applet doesn't work. These messages are emitted when run from a terminal: FoxyProxy settingsDir = /home/sthorne/.mozilla/firefox/lq8qgj2c.default IcedTeaPlugin.cc:3685: Error: create process IcedTeaPlugin.cc:1660: Error: started appletviewer (firefox:6209): GLib-CRITICAL **: g_io_channel_write_chars: assertion `channel != NULL' failed IcedTeaPlugin.cc:3894: Error: Failed to write bytes to output channel (firefox:6209): GLib-CRITICAL **: g_io_channel_flush: assertion `channel != NULL' failed IcedTeaPlugin.cc:3908: Error: Failed to flush bytes to output channel Expected results: Java applet works.
I didn't mention, installing later versions of java fix the problem. These resolve the problem: java-1.6.0-openjdk-1.6.0.0-20.b14.fc11.x86_64 java-1.6.0-openjdk-plugin-1.6.0.0-20.b14.fc11.x86_64
